WLK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

356 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Westlake Corp (WLK)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$5.08B — up 9.4% from $4.64B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 57 funds opened new WLK positions and 29 closed out — a net gain of 28 holders — while 104 added to existing stakes and 136 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$85.8M. The largest seller was Orbis Allan Gray, cutting an estimated $48.8M.
